Secondary campus will be taking MAP tests this week. We will take ELA, Reading, math, and science. These tests are very important. They give us an opportunity to see how your child has grown since the beginning of the year compared to other students in the same grade. Each student has made a goal with their teacher. Please encourage your students to give their best effort this week.
